Educational Paraprofessional Sample Clauses

Educational Paraprofessional. The primary distinction of this position is to assist teacher(s) with lesson preparation, assessments, and classroom management. This position will require the performance of certain medical procedures on students (i.e., G- tube feeding, catheterization, etc.) as identified in the Health and Educational Aides job description/job posting.
